Abstract(in English) | Recently young people easily commit cybercrime. Educational institutions have an obligation to implement compliance training in order to prevent young students from getting involved in cybercrime. This study aims to assess the level of knowledge about cybercrime among young students, to grasp differences in knowledge about cybercrime between Japanese and international students, and to measure the effect of introduction of incidents and cases familiar to young students in the lecture. A questionnaire survey revealed that there are many differences between international and Japanese students in terms of knowledge of cybercrime law but both students have insufficient knowledge. We found that a short lecture based on familiar incidents and cases brings a significant educational effect. |
